Apollo Capital Solutions (ACS) provides companies with efficient and centralized access to capital by supporting cross-platform origination, capital markets, and syndication. The ACS Private Equity Capital Markets team is seeking an Analyst to join the team.
Primary Responsibilities
- Work with deals teams and support senior-level capital markets professionals in determining, recommending, and negotiating optimal capital structures for portfolio companies
- Attend all investment committee meetings to help generate idea flow
- Develop timely insight into current capital markets, including forces driving the markets, types of lenders in the markets, debt solutions available, etc.
- Help support senior level team in driving execution processes for portfolio company financings
- Maintain relationships with capital markets and banking teams focused on core verticals at each investment bank
- Maintain relationships with institutional debt investors and investment banking teams to encourage direct dialogue, partnership opportunities, and syndication participation
- Prepare, organize, and maintain deal-related marketing materials and analyses
- Prepare and organize team-level and portfolio-level data processes and projects
- Help build and maintain databases relevant to the business
Qualifications & Experience
- 1-2 years of analyst experience at a leading investment bank preferably within a coverage team such as software/technology, media/telecom, healthcare, consumer/retail, etc
- Strong attention to detail with a proven ability to multitask and operate as both a self-starter and team player
- Strong financial acumen, data analysis, and presentation (i.e., Excel, PowerPoint) skills
- Excellent written, oral communication and reasoning skills
- Ability to work under pressure in a rapidly changing environment to meet deadlines
